区块链技术标准全面解析:现状与未来

区块链是一种去中心化的分布式账本技术,在过去的十年里,随着比特币的兴起和其它加密货币的发展,区块链技术逐渐走入了大众的视野。它不仅仅是加密货币的基础支撑,还应用于金融、供应链、物联网等多个领域。但随着区块链技术的不断发展和应用场景的丰富,如何制定统一的技术标准以保证不同区块链系统之间的互操作性和安全性,成为了当务之急。

在本篇文章中,我们将详细解析区块链的技术标准,包括其重要性、当前的技术标准及其特点、未来的方向,以及行业中存在的挑战和机遇。

1. 区块链技术标准的重要性

区块链技术标准的重要性可以从几个方面来理解。首先,标准化可以促进区块链技术的互联互通。当前市场上存在多种区块链技术,彼此之间的兼容性问题成为制约其发展的瓶颈。一旦制定了统一的标准,不同区块链之间的数据和资产能够自由流转,从而提升整个网络的效率和价值。

其次,标准化有助于保障安全性和隐私。区块链技术涉及大量的敏感数据,标准化能够帮助建立统一的安全协议和隐私保护机制,提升用户的信任度,从而更好地推动技术的普及和应用。

最后,标准化还能够促进行业合作。许多企业和机构对区块链技术都进行了探索,但缺乏统一的标准导致资源的浪费和重复研发。通过标准化,能够鼓励更多的企业进行合作,共享技术与经验,从而加速技术创新和应用进程。

2. 当前区块链技术标准的概述

区块链技术标准的制定主要由一些国际标准化组织、行业协会和技术社区来推进。主要的标准包括但不限于:

  • ISO/TC 307:国际标准化组织(ISO)成立的区块链和分布式账本技术技术委员会,负责制定区块链相关的国际标准,涵盖技术架构、数据质量、隐私保护等多个方面。
  • Ethereum ERC 标准:以太坊网络的以太坊请求评论(ERC)标准,旨在制定在以太坊上进行智能合约和代币创建的规范,最有名的比如ERC-20和ERC-721。
  • W3C 区块链社区组:万维网联盟(W3C)成立的区块链社区,关注区块链在Web技术中的应用,探索去中心化身份、权限管理等标准。
  • Libra 协议:Facebook曾推出的Libra项目也致力于建立一个新的数字货币及其背后的技术标准,尽管经历了一些波折,但其设定的标准仍对行业产生了深远的影响。

以上这些标准体现了区块链生态系统中的共同目标:促进不同区块链系统间的互操作性,保障数据的安全性和隐私性,提升用户的使用体验。

3. 面临的挑战与机遇

尽管区块链技术标准化的倡议已有所进展,但在实际操作中仍面临许多挑战。首先,不同地区、行业的需求差异使得标准的制定过程复杂且漫长。各国监管政策的不同也让区块链标准的统一变得困难。

其次,技术发展迅速,一些新的技术和应用不断出现,现有的标准可能无法及时跟上。这就要求标准化机构要保持灵活性,及时更新和修订相关标准,以适应快速变化的市场需求。

然而,除了挑战之外,区块链技术标准化也带来了许多机遇。随着越来越多的企业意识到标准的重要性,投资和资源将不断涌入相关领域,推动技术创新。同时,行业间的合作将更加紧密,共同推进区块链技术的成熟与应用。

4. 区块链技术标准的未来发展方向

展望未来,区块链技术标准化的方向可以从以下几个方面进行考虑:

  • 跨链技术:跨链技术的快速发展将成为区块链互操作性的关键,未来将会出现更多针对跨链的标准,以促进不同区块链之间的数据和资产流通。
  • 生态系统标准化:未来的区块链标准化将进一步向生态系统发展,不仅仅局限于技术层面,还包含应用层面,如行业标准、治理标准等。
  • 隐私保护标准:随着对数据隐私的关注增加,未来将更加重视隐私保护的标准化,建立统一的隐私保护机制和合规要求。
  • 可持续性标准:在全球对于环境可持续性日益重视的背景下,区块链技术也需要考虑其在能源消耗和碳排放上的影响,建立相关的可持续性标准成为一种趋势。

区块链技术标准化进程的推进,不仅可以促进区块链技术的进一步发展,还将为各行各业带来深远的影响和机遇。随着行业的发展与成熟,标准化的工作必将成为推动区块链技术应用的重要一环。

相关问题解析

1. 如何实现不同区块链之间的互操作性?

实现不同区块链之间的互操作性是当前区块链技术标准化的一项重要目标。不同区块链系统之间的互操作性,可以通过几种技术手段来促进。

首先,跨链技术是实现互操作性的主要解决方案之一。通过跨链技术,能够实现不同区块链之间的数据交换和资产转移。例如,Polkadot和Cosmos等项目就通过构建跨链架构,允许不同区块链进行通信和协作。

其次,标准化协议的制定也是推动互操作性的关键。例如,建立一些通用的数据格式和通信协议,让不同区块链之间能够顺利交流和交互数据。这需要行业内的广泛合作和统一标准的制定,以消除各个系统之间的技术壁垒。

此外,一些去中心化的交换平台也在逐渐涌现,这些平台能够提供跨链资产交换的功能,用户可以在不同区块链之间方便地进行交易。

最后,对于开发者而言,编写更为兼容的智能合约和应用程序也是提升互操作性的重要手段。通过采用开放的API接口和规范化的开发流程,开发者能够构建具备更高兼容性的应用。

2. 区块链技术标准化的现状如何?

区块链技术标准化的现状可以用“起步阶段”来形容。尽管已有一些组织和机构在积极推动标准的制定,但整体进展依然缓慢。

一方面,确实有些国际标准化组织和行业协会正在积极开发相关的标准,例如ISO/TC 307,但这些标准仍在草拟或提议阶段,实际应用还尚未普遍普及。许多企业依然在单独开发自己的解决方案,标准化的需求尚未形成强烈的共识。

另一方面,区块链领域的技术发展极其迅速,新兴技术层出不穷,现有标准很难及时跟进。这就导致了“标准滞后”的问题,许多新技术无法在发表后迅速被纳入标准中。

尽管存在这些挑战,区块链技术标准化的趋势依然向好。越来越多的会议、论坛和研讨会关注区块链标准化问题,行业内的共识正在逐渐形成。

3. 区块链技术标准的影响有哪些?

区块链技术标准的影响是深远的,尤其是在技术的发展、应用的推广、以及行业的合作上,都发挥着重要的作用。

首先,技术标准化有助于推动区块链技术的普及。当技术标准得到广泛采用后,开发者可以更加轻松地应用这些标准来构建和部署区块链系统,从而降低了技术门槛,也加快了开发速度。

其次,标准化可以提升区块链应用的安全性。当存在统一的安全标准时,企业和用户能够明确了解并遵循这些标准,从而增强了对区块链技术的信任度,推动其在更广泛领域中的应用。

最后,标准化促进了行业之间的合作与协作。当不同组织和企业能够在既定标准下进行合作时,资源的整合与共享便成为可能,行业内的创新速度将得以提升。

4. 如何参与区块链技术标准的制定?

若想参与区块链技术标准的制定,首先需要对区块链技术本身有深入的理解和认识。无论是在技术开发、应用解决方案,还是在行业政策方面,都需要具备一定的专业知识。

第一步,企业可以通过加入相关的行业协会或标准化组织来获取参与机会。例如,ISO、W3C、以及各国的区块链协会都是关注标准化问题的重要机构。

其次,积极参与讨论和论证会。当相关组织举办关于区块链标准的会议时,企业及其代表可以提出自己的观点和建议,参与到标准的讨论和制定过程中。

第三,企业和组织也能够通过开源项目的方式,贡献自己的技术实现,从而影响标准的制定。例如,很多区块链项目都是以开源方式进行,参与者能够借此发挥自己的技术优势,形成对整个区块链标准的影响。

综上所述,区块链技术标准化虽处于起步阶段,但其重要性和影响力不可小觑。通过各方的努力,未来区块链技术标准将不断演化和完善,推动整个行业的进一步发展。